$K\to3\pi$ Decays in Chiral Perturbation Theory

Abstract

The CP conserving amplitudes for the decays K3πK\to3\pi are calculated in Chiral Perturbation Theory at the next-to-leading order. We present the expressions in a compact form with single parameter functions only. These expressions are then fitted to all available K2πK\to2\pi and K3πK\to3\pi data to obtain a fit of the parameters that occur. We compare with the work of Kambor, Missimer and Wyler.
